Add a rule to the access profile
After you add the access profile, you can add one or more security access rules to the access
profile.
If you access the switch from a computer, make sure that you add a permit rule for the type of
service that you use (for example, HTTPS), your computer’s IP address, and your computer’s
subnet mask.
CAUTION:
You must add a permit rule for your device and access method, otherwise
you are locked out from the switch after you activate the access profile. If
that situation occurs, you must reset the switch to factory default settings
